Senior Research Associate - Analytical Development

BrainChild Bio · Seattle, WA · 1 wk ago
HybridFull-time

Responsibilities

  • Work collaboratively with internal Process Development and Analytical Development teams.
  • Aid in experimental execution in support of molecular assay development and qualification, including ddPCR/qPCR-based methods.
  • Perform routine molecular analytics (e.g., ddPCR) and provide data in a timely manner to support process studies.
  • Support development and execution of lentiviral vector characterization assays for process development and process characterization activities.
  • Author ELNs, methods, reports and SOPs.

Qualifications

  • BA/BS in biochemistry, molecular biology, biology, microbiology or related discipline.
  • 2–5 years of industry experience in a life sciences laboratory.
  • Proficiency with life science data acquisition and analysis tools (Excel, Prism) and ELNs desired.
  • Previous experience with molecular biology techniques (ddPCR/qPCR) and nucleic acid handling is highly desired.
  • Experience supporting assay development, qualification and/or troubleshooting is a plus.
  • A team player with a track record of successfully operating within cross-functional teams.
